Out-of-school rate for children of primary school age, urban, female in Uganda
Uganda: Out-of-school rate for children of primary school age, urban, female was 4.8% in 2023. ▼ Falling
Out-of-school rate for children of primary school age, urban, female in Uganda, 2001–2023
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
Uganda recorded 4.8% for out-of-school rate for children of primary school age, urban, female in 2023. That is the lowest value across all 5 years on record.
The figure is down 2.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, out-of-school rate for children of primary school age, urban, female in Uganda peaked at 11.0% in 2001 and was at its lowest, 4.8%, in 2023.
Uganda ranks 17th of 46 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
Out-of-school rate for children of primary school age, urban, female in Uganda,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2001 | 11.0% | — |
| 2006 | 7.3% | -33.3% |
| 2011 | 4.9% | -33.8% |
| 2016 | 6.1% | +25.3% |
| 2023 | 4.8% | -21.8% |
Uganda compared with similar countries
- Uganda's 4.8% is below the median for low income countries, which is 6.0%, 79% of the median. (9 countries reporting)
- Uganda's 4.8% is below the median for Sub-Saharan Africa, which is 6.0%, 79% of the median. (21 countries reporting)
